Reefer containers, short for refrigerated containers, are specialized shipping containers designed to transport temperature-sensitive goods across long distances by sea, road, or rail. These containers feature integrated refrigeration units that maintain a consistent temperature throughout transit—ensuring the quality, safety, and freshness of perishable products.

Each unit is equipped with an electric-powered refrigeration system that connects to the vessel’s or terminal’s power supply. For road or rail transit, portable generators (gensets) may be used to keep the container powered during transfer stages.
